Riz de Quinoa
Riz de Quinoa is a delightful low-carb French rice dish that elegantly substitutes traditional rice with nutty quinoa, creating a light yet filling meal. Enhanced with aromatic herbs and vegetables, it offers a refined taste experience perfect for any occasion.

30 minutes
Difficulty: Easy
French
320 kcal
Ingredients
- Quinoa - 150 grams
- Vegetable broth - 500 ml
- Zucchini - 100 grams, diced
- Red bell pepper - 100 grams, diced
- Shallots - 50 grams, minced
- Garlic - 2 cloves, minced
- Olive oil - 2 tablespoons
- Fresh thyme - 1 teaspoon, chopped
- Salt - to taste
- Black pepper - to taste
- Fresh parsley - for garnish
Steps
- Rinse the quinoa under cold water to remove any bitterness, then drain.
- In a saucepan, heat the olive oil over medium heat and sauté the minced shallots and garlic until translucent, about 2-3 minutes.
- Add the diced zucchini and red bell pepper to the pan, cooking for an additional 5 minutes until softened.
- Stir in the rinsed quinoa, chopped thyme, salt, and pepper, mixing well to combine.
- Pour in the vegetable broth and bring to a boil. Reduce the heat to low, cover, and let it simmer for 15 minutes or until the quinoa is cooked and the liquid is absorbed.
- Remove from heat and let it sit, covered, for 5 minutes. Fluff with a fork.
- Serve warm, garnished with fresh parsley.
